body {
  margin: 0px;
  padding: 0px;
  background: url(fon.jpg) no-repeat top center;
  text-align: center;
  font-family: Georgia;
  font-size: 15px;
  color: #8d8984;
}
.container {
  width: 1000px;
  height: 1000px;
  background: url(main_center_fon.jpg) no-repeat top center;
  margin-left: auto;
  margin-right: auto;
  text-align: left;
  position: relative;  
}
a {
  font-family: Times New Roman;
  font-size: 16px;
  color: #0061a7;
  text-decoration: none;
}
a:hover {
  text-decoration: underline;
  color: #ff0000;
}
.logo {
  width: 220px;
  height: 68px;
  background: url(logo.gif) no-repeat top left;
  position: absolute;
  top: 54px;
  left: 280px;
}
.c_tm:hover {
  opacity: 0.7;
  filter:progid:DXImageTransform.Microsoft.Alpha(opacity=70);
}
.text {
  width: 365px;
  line-height: 130%;
  position: absolute;
  top: 105px;
  left: 535px;
}
.footer_table {
  line-height: 150%;
  position: absolute;
  top: 680px;
  left: 515px;

}
.footer_table td {
  vertical-align: middle;
}

.footer_table .td1 {
  padding-right: 10px;
  font-family: Times New Roman;
  font-size: 16px;
  color: #a58580;
  text-align: right;
  padding-bottom: 8px;
}
.footer_table .td2 {
  font-family: Times New Roman;
  font-size: 23px;
  color: #887b78;
  padding-bottom: 5px;
}
.footer_table .td3 {
  padding-right: 10px;
  font-family: Times New Roman;
  font-size: 16px;
  color: #5b5a5a;
  text-align: right;
  padding-bottom: 2px;
}
.footer_table .td4, .footer_table .td6 {
  font-size: 24px;
  color: #865954;
  padding-bottom: 8px;
}
.footer_table .td4 a, .footer_table .td6 a {
  color: #0f6aac;
  font-size: 24px;
  text-decoration: none;
}
.footer_table .td4 a:hover,  .footer_table .td6 a:hover {
  text-decoration: underline;
  color: #0f6aac;
}
.footer_table .td5 {
  padding-bottom: 5px;
  color: #5b5a5a;
}
 .footer_table .td6 a:hover {
   color: #ff0000;
 }

.footer_table .td5, .footer_table .td7 {
  text-align: right;
  padding-right: 10px;
  font-family: Times New Roman;
  font-size: 16px;
}

.podrobnee {
  width: 165px;
  height: 64px;
  padding-left: 6px;
  padding-top: 10px;
  line-height: 100%;
  background: url(podr.gif) no-repeat top left;
  position: absolute;
  top: 210px;
  left: 533px;
}
.baza {
  width: 148px;
  height: 41px;
  padding-left: 10px;
  padding-top: 5px;
  line-height: 100%;
  background: url(baza.jpg) no-repeat top left;
  position: absolute;
  top: 311px;
  left: 364px;
}
.soprovogdenie {
  width: 214px;
  height: 56px;
  padding-left: 8px;
  padding-top: 3px;
  line-height: 100%;
  background: url(soprovogdenie.jpg) no-repeat top left;
  position: absolute;
  top: 404px;
  left: 86px;
}
.lizing {
  width: 66px;
  height: 28px;
  padding-left: 11px;
  padding-top: 6px;
  line-height: 100%;
  background: url(lizing.jpg) no-repeat top left;
  position: absolute;
  top: 233px;
  left: 905px;
}
.help {
  width: 94px;
  height: 28px;
  padding-left: 4px;
  padding-top: 6px;
  line-height: 100%;
  background: url(help.jpg) no-repeat top left;
  position: absolute;
  top: 342px;
  left: 656px;
}

.ocenka {
  width: 167px;
  height: 23px;
  padding-left: 12px;
  padding-top: 4px;
  line-height: 100%;
  background: url(ocenka.jpg) no-repeat top left;
  position: absolute;
  top: 609px;
  left: 287px;
}
.pereplanirovka {
  width: 151px;
  height: 39px;
  padding-left: 4px;
  padding-top: 7px;
  line-height: 100%;
  background: url(pereplan.jpg) no-repeat top left;
  position: absolute;
  top: 611px;
  left: 14px;
}
.consult {
  width: 168px;
  height: 40px;
  padding-left: 9px;
  padding-top: 5px;
  line-height: 100%;
  background: url(consult.jpg) no-repeat top left;
  position: absolute;
  top: 463px;
  left: 490px;
}
.c_tm {
  width: 136px;
  height: 27px;
  background: url(main_c_tm.jpg) no-repeat top left;
  position: absolute;
  top: 768px;
  left: 262px;
}

.c_tm_text {
  width: 120px;
  font-family: Times New Roman;
  font-size: 14px;
  color: #000000;
  text-decoration: none;
  position: absolute;
  top: 773px;
  left: 157px;
}
.c_tm_text:hover {
  text-decoration: underline;
  color: #000000;
}


